Rear Panel Connections and Switch

Connect the MC2301 power cord to a live AC outlet. Refer to the rear panel to determine the correct voltage

Main Fuse holder, refer to information on the back panel of your MC2301 to determine the cor- rect fuse size and rating

POWER CONTROL IN receives a turn On/Off signal from a McIntosh component and the

POWER CONTROL OUT sends a turn On/Off signal to the next McIn- tosh Component

BALANCED INput1 / OUTput for an audio cable from a Pre- amplifier output or to connect an audio cable on to the next Power Amplifier input

INPUT MODE switch selects between balanced or unbalanced input
